Q: Is 1,354,570 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 1,354,570 is a composite number.

Why is 1,354,570 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 1,354,570 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 7 10 14 35 37 70 74 185 259 370 518 523 1,046 1,295 2,590 2,615 3,661 5,230 7,322 18,305 19,351 36,610 38,702 96,755 135,457 193,510 270,914 677,285 and 1,354,570, with no remainder.

Since 1,354,570 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,354,570, it is a composite number.
